Brazil: The Regional Giant

  • Talent Pool: Brazil dominates the region with the largest talent pool, boasting over 1.5 million IT professionals and more than 750,000 software developers. The country’s strong educational infrastructure produces a continuous stream of STEM graduates.
  • Major Tech Hubs: São Paulo is the beating heart of Brazilian tech, home to numerous unicorns like Nubank and serving as a headquarters for global giants like Google and Netflix.
  • Average Salary: A mid level software engineer in Brazil can expect an annual salary in the range of $31,480. However, rates can be higher for specialized roles in AI and data analytics.
  • Market Outlook: The Brazilian software market is projected to continue its strong growth, driven by massive investments in fintech, e commerce, and healthtech.

Mexico: The Nearshore Powerhouse

  • Talent Pool: Mexico has the largest tech talent pool in the region with over 800,000 developers and produces more than 110,000 new engineers and technologists each year.
  • Major Tech Hubs: Mexico City has surpassed São Paulo as the largest tech talent hub in Latin America, with over 300,000 tech specialists. Guadalajara is often called the “Silicon Valley of Mexico” and, along with Monterrey, forms a powerful network of innovation.
  • Average Salary: The average salary for a software developer in Mexico is around $28,420 annually, offering a significant cost advantage compared to the U.S.
  • Market Outlook: Mexico’s IT industry is projected to grow significantly, with a strong focus on fintech and e commerce. Its proximity and alignment with U.S. markets make it a top choice for nearshoring.

Argentina: Elite Talent and English Proficiency

  • Talent Pool: Argentina is home to a highly educated workforce of approximately 115,000 professional software developers, with around 27,000 new tech graduates annually. The country is recognized for having the highest English proficiency in Latin America.
  • Major Tech Hubs: Buenos Aires is the primary tech hub, known for its deep engineering culture and iconic tech companies like Mercado Libre. Córdoba and Mendoza are also growing innovation centers.
  • Average Salary: While average salaries are competitive, around $21,300, senior developers with specialized skills can command much higher rates.
  • Market Outlook: Argentina’s tech ecosystem is a leader in biotechnology and fintech, driven by a strong entrepreneurial spirit and a record of successful global projects.

Colombia: The Fastest Growing Ecosystem

  • Talent Pool: Colombia has a rapidly expanding talent pool of over 60,000 software developers, supported by strong government investment in tech education. The country is a leader in producing professionals trained in technological fields.
  • Major Tech Hubs: Bogotá is a major innovation hub with a dynamic startup scene. Medellín has been recognized as one of the fastest growing tech talent hubs in the region.
  • Average Salary: The average salary for a software developer in Colombia is approximately $25,150.
  • Market Outlook: Colombia’s tech sector is projected to grow significantly, with a strong focus on fintech, AI, cybersecurity, and blockchain. It has become a preferred destination for IT outsourcing.

Uruguay: A Hub of Stability and Innovation

  • Talent Pool: With over 24,000 tech professionals, Uruguay has a highly skilled workforce and boasts the top ranking in Latin America for tech skills. The industry is projected to need 15,000 new developers to meet demand.
  • Major Tech Hubs: Montevideo is the vibrant center of the country’s tech ecosystem, home to over 530 IT companies and a thriving startup culture.
  • Average Salary: Software developer salaries are competitive, with an average of around $37,950 annually.
  • Market Outlook: Often called the “Silicon Valley of South America”, Uruguay’s tech market is growing at 21% annually. The government’s Digital Agenda 2025 is fostering innovation in AI, IoT, and digital health.

Costa Rica: Education and Tech Excellence

  • Talent Pool: Costa Rica has a skilled workforce of over 45,000 tech specialists, supported by a strong educational system that prioritizes STEM fields.
  • Major Tech Hubs: The majority of tech talent is concentrated in San Jose, Heredia, Alajuela, and Cartago. The country is a hub for major industry players like Amazon and Intel.
  • Average Salary: With an average annual salary of $39,800, Costa Rica is one of the top paying countries for software developers in the region.
  • Market Outlook: The country’s stable business climate and government support have made it a go to destination for outsourcing, particularly in fintech, healthtech, and cybersecurity.

The Risks of Direct Hiring and the EOR Solution

Hiring international talent directly can expose companies to significant risks. Each country has unique labor laws, tax regulations, and compliance standards. Misclassifying workers can lead to legal disputes, fines, and unexpected costs related to back taxes and benefits, quickly outweighing any initial savings.

This is why many U.S. companies choose to work with an Employer of Record (EOR) when hiring software engineers Latin America. An EOR is a third party organization that legally employs talent on your behalf. This partner handles all the administrative functions like payroll, benefits, tax compliance, and HR, assuming the legal risks associated with local labor laws. Using an EOR allows your company to access top talent quickly and compliantly without the need to establish a local legal entity. Java Developer Seniority Levels Explained

When you set out to hire remote Java developers, you’ll encounter three main experience levels: Junior, Mid Level, and Senior. Understanding the differences is key to finding the right fit for your project.

Junior Java Developer

A junior developer typically has less than two years of professional experience. They focus on writing code for smaller, well defined tasks under the supervision of a more experienced team member. They are in a learning phase, fixing bugs, implementing simple features, and growing their skills.

Mid Level Java Developer

With roughly two to five years of experience, a mid level developer can work independently on more complex projects. They understand the full software development lifecycle and contribute to design discussions. They are highly productive and in strong demand.

Senior Java Developer

A senior developer usually has over five years of experience and brings deep expertise in Java and its ecosystem. They do more than just code. They provide leadership, mentor junior developers, and make high level architectural decisions. Seniors are rare, making them incredibly valuable for solving complex problems and guiding teams.

Core Skills for a Modern Remote Java Developer

A successful Java developer combines technical prowess with strong problem solving abilities. Here are the core skills to look for when you hire remote Java developers in 2026.

Foundational Technical Skills

  • Java Language Proficiency: A developer must have a deep understanding of Java syntax, Object Oriented Programming (OOP) principles, and core APIs for things like collections and concurrency. For 2026, this includes familiarity with features from recent LTS versions like Java 21, including Virtual Threads from Project Loom, Records, and Pattern Matching.
  • Frameworks and Libraries: Modern development relies on frameworks. The Spring framework, especially Spring Boot 3, is the undisputed leader for building enterprise applications. Experience with other tools like Hibernate for database interaction or JUnit for testing is also crucial.
  • Web and Database Skills: Since Java is often used for back end development, knowledge of RESTful web services, the Model View Controller (MVC) pattern, and SQL is essential. The ability to design and optimize database queries is a highly valued skill.
  • Essential Tools: Proficiency with standard development tools is non negotiable. This includes version control with Git and build tools like Maven or Gradle. Familiarity with Continuous Integration and Continuous Deployment (CI/CD) pipelines is also a common requirement.

Cloud Native and Microservices Mastery

Modern Java applications are built for the cloud. A top developer should be proficient in:

  • Microservices Patterns: Understanding concepts like service discovery, API gateways, and distributed tracing is critical for building scalable systems.
  • Containerization: Expertise with Docker for packaging applications and Kubernetes for orchestrating them is now a standard expectation.
  • Cloud Platforms: Experience with at least one major cloud provider (AWS, Azure, or GCP) is essential. They should know how to use key services like managed databases, message queues, and serverless functions.
  • Cloud Native Runtimes: While not required for all roles, familiarity with frameworks like Quarkus or Micronaut, which are optimized for fast startup times and low memory usage, is a huge plus.

A Mindset for Quality and Observability

Great developers build resilient and maintainable software. Look for a commitment to:

  • Comprehensive Testing: They should be skilled in writing unit, integration, and end to end tests.
  • Code Quality: They follow best practices, participate actively in code reviews, and aim for clean, readable code.
  • Observability: Knowledge of tools and practices like OpenTelemetry for collecting metrics, logs, and traces is vital for monitoring application health in production.

Essential Soft Skills

Technical skills are only half the story. Strong communication, teamwork, and analytical thinking are what separate good developers from great ones. The ability to explain technical concepts clearly and collaborate effectively is vital, especially in a remote setting.

Interview Questions and Assessment Rubric

A multi stage interview process helps you assess skills comprehensively.

Round 1: Technical Screening

Focus on core concepts with a coding challenge or a live coding session.

  • Core Java: “Explain the difference between == and .equals().” “How does Java handle memory management?” “Describe a recent feature in Java you find interesting, like Virtual Threads.”
  • Spring Boot: “What is dependency injection and how does Spring facilitate it?” “Explain the purpose of the @RestController and @Service annotations.” “How would you handle exceptions in a Spring Boot REST API?”
  • Data Structures & Algorithms: “How would you find the second largest element in an array?” “When would you use a HashMap versus a TreeMap?”

Round 2: System Design and Architecture

Assess their ability to think about the bigger picture.

  • Microservices: “How would you design a simple e commerce system with services for users, products, and orders?” “What are the pros and cons of synchronous versus asynchronous communication between services?”
  • Cloud: “Describe how you would deploy a Java application to be scalable and highly available on AWS.” “What is the purpose of an API Gateway in a microservices architecture?”

Round 3: Behavioral and Cultural Fit

Ensure they can thrive in your remote environment.

  • “Tell me about a challenging technical problem you solved and how you approached it.”
  • “How do you prefer to communicate and collaborate with a remote team?”
  • “Describe a time you disagreed with a team member. How did you handle it?”

Employee vs. Contractor vs. Employer of Record (EOR)

This is a critical decision. While hiring contractors seems simple, misclassification carries significant legal and financial risks. An Employer of Record, or EOR, is a third party that legally employs the developer on your behalf, managing all local HR, payroll, benefits, and taxes.

  • Contractor: You have less control, and misclassification can lead to severe penalties for back taxes and unpaid benefits.
  • Direct Employee: Requires you to set up a legal entity in the developer’s country, which is complex, expensive, and time consuming.
  • EOR Employee (Recommended): The EOR handles all legal and administrative burdens, allowing you to hire globally with minimal risk and overhead. This is the model used by most reputable talent partners.

Structuring Your Remote Developer Contract

Whether using an EOR or hiring a contractor, your agreement should include key clauses:

  • Confidentiality and NDAs: Protect your sensitive information.
  • Intellectual Property (IP) Assignment: A “work for hire” clause ensures all code and work product belongs to your company.
  • Termination and Notice Period: Clearly define the terms for ending the contract.
  • Data Protection: Include language to comply with regulations like GDPR or CCPA if you handle personal data.

What’s New in React Native for 2025?

React Native continues to evolve, with the new architecture becoming the standard for modern development. This overhaul delivers significant performance gains by enabling direct communication between JavaScript and native code, eliminating the old, slower “bridge”. Key components of this architecture include:

  • JSI (JavaScript Interface): Allows for direct, synchronous communication between JS and native threads, resulting in faster method calls and smoother animations.
  • TurboModules: These are native modules that are loaded only when needed (lazy loading), which dramatically improves app startup times.
  • Fabric Renderer: A new rendering system that creates a more responsive user interface and fixes layout bottlenecks, leading to a smoother user experience, especially in complex screens.

These updates make React Native apps faster, more stable, and more capable of handling complex tasks than ever before.

React Native vs. The Alternatives

In 2025, the cross platform world is dominated by a few key players. While React Native remains a leader with a massive developer ecosystem, other frameworks offer different advantages.

  • Flutter: Backed by Google, Flutter is known for its high performance and beautiful, consistent UI across platforms. It uses the Dart programming language and its own rendering engine, which gives developers a high degree of control over the user experience.
  • Kotlin Multiplatform (KMP): KMP is a pragmatic choice that allows developers to share business logic across platforms while retaining native UI components. This makes it ideal for companies that want to maximize code reuse without sacrificing the native look and feel of their applications.

While React Native holds a dominant market share, the choice of framework often depends on project goals and existing team skills.

Interview Stages and Sample Questions

A multi stage process helps evaluate different competencies.

  1. Recruiter Screen (30 mins): Focus on cultural fit, motivation, and salary expectations.
  2. Technical Interview (60 mins): Dive into core concepts.
    • “Can you explain the difference between props and state in React?”
    • “How does the new React Native architecture (Fabric and TurboModules) improve performance over the old bridge?”
    • “When would you use a FlatList versus a ScrollView, and how do you optimize list performance?”
    • “How do you handle platform specific code for iOS and Android?”
  3. Live Coding Challenge (60 to 90 mins): Assess practical skills. Ask the candidate to build a simple screen with components that fetch data from a public API. This reveals their ability to structure code, manage state, and handle asynchronous operations.
  4. Final Interview (45 mins): Meet with the engineering manager or CTO. Discuss past projects, team collaboration, and long term goals.
